Решение ошибки: формат или расширение файла недопустимы в Excel

Ситуация, когда при попытке запуска документа программа выдает сообщение "эксель не удается открыть файл так как формат или расширение этого файла являются недопустимыми", часто застает пользователя врасплох. Это стандартное уведомление системы безопасности, которое блокирует доступ к содержимому, если обнаруживает несоответствие между реальным внутренним кодом файла и его заявленным расширением. Обычно такое происходит после некорректного скачивания из интернета, переноса данных с другого устройства или сбоя в работе самой офисной программы.

Паниковать в этот момент не стоит, так как ваши данные, скорее всего, целы и просто скрыты за барьером проверки безопасности. Расширение файла — это лишь метка для операционной системы, сообщающая, каким прилением нужно открывать документ, в то время как внутренний формат содержит непосредственную структуру данных. Если эти два элемента не совпадают, Microsoft Excel автоматически прерывает запуск, чтобы предотвратить потенциальное заражение компьютера макросами или вредоносным кодом.

В этой статье мы подробно разберем алгоритмы действий, которые помогут вам восстановить доступ к важным таблицам. Мы рассмотрим как штатные средства защиты, так и специализированные методы восстановления, которые часто игнорируются обычными пользователями. Понимание природы этой ошибки позволит вам не только открыть текущий документ, но и избежать подобных проблем в будущем при работе с электронными таблицами.

Причины возникновения конфликта форматов и расширений

Основной причиной появления ошибки является рассинхронизация между тем, что "видит" операционная система, и тем, что "понимает" офисный пакет. Часто пользователи вручную переименовывают файлы, меняя расширение, например, с .xlsx на .xls, полагая, что это сделает файл совместимым со старой версией программы. Однако внутренняя структура данных остается прежней, и при попытке чтения Excel натыкается на неожиданные заголовки блоков, что и вызывает блокировку.

Другой распространенный сценарий связан с загрузкой данных из внешних источников, таких как корпоративные порталы, облачные хранилища или почтовые клиенты. В процессе передачи через интернет файл может быть поврежден, или же сервер может изменить его MIME-тип, что приведет к искажению заголовка документа. В таких случаях файловая система помечает объект как подозрительный, даже если его содержимое не было затронуто физически.

⚠️ Внимание: Никогда не игнорируйте предупреждения системы безопасности, если вы не уверены в источнике файла. Попытка принудительного открытия исполняемого скрипта, замаскированного под таблицу, может привести к компрометации данных.

Также стоит учитывать человеческий фактор: иногда пользователи сохраняют файл в одном формате (например, CSV или XML), но при сохранении ошибочно выбирают другое расширение. В результате получается гибридная структура, которую стандартный парсер Excel не может корректно интерпретировать без предварительной подготовки. Понимание архитектуры файлов помогает быстрее диагностировать проблему.

📊 Как вы чаще всего получаете файлы, вызывающие ошибки?
По электронной почте
Через мессенджеры
С флеш-накопителя
Из облачного хранилища
С корпоративного сервера

Использование режима защищенного просмотра

Первым и самым безопасным шагом для обхода блокировки является использование встроенного механизма "Защищенного просмотра". Когда вы видите сообщение об ошибке, в диалоговом окне часто присутствует кнопка "Открыть в защищенном режиме" или аналогичная опция в желтой полосе предупреждения сверху документа. Этот режим изолирует файл в песочнице, позволяя просмотреть содержимое без запуска потенциально опасных скриптов.

Если файл откроется в этом режиме, вы увидите ограниченный функционал: многие кнопки будут неактивны, а редактирование запрещено. Однако это дает вам возможность сохранить копию документа в корректном формате. Для этого необходимо перейти в меню Файл → Сохранить как и выбрать актуальный формат, например, Книга Excel (*.xlsx). После сохранения новой копии старый проблемный файл можно удалить.

В некоторых случаях стандартное окно безопасности не появляется, и файл просто не открывается. Тогда можно попробовать обойти блокировку через свойства самого файла в проводнике Windows. Найдите документ, нажмите на него правой кнопкой мыши и выберите "Свойства". Внизу вкладки "Общие" может находиться кнопка "Разблокировать", снятие галочки с которой снимает метку о происхождении из интернета.

Важно отметить, что режим защищенного просмотра можно настроить через центр управления безопасностью. Перейдите в Файл → Параметры → Центр управления безопасностью → Параметры центра управления безопасностью → Защищенный просмотр. Здесь можно временно отключить проверки для файлов из интернета, но делать это следует только если вы абсолютно уверены в безопасности всех загружаемых данных.

Принудительное открытие через меню программы

Если двойной клик по иконке файла приводит только к появлению ошибки, попробуйте запустить саму программу Microsoft Excel отдельно, без загрузки документа. После запуска пустого приложения перейдите в меню Файл → Открыть → Обзор. В появившемся диалоговом окне найдите ваш проблемный файл, выделите его, но не нажимайте кнопку "Открыть" сразу.

Обратите внимание на стрелку рядом с кнопкой "Открыть". Нажав на нее, вы увидите выпадающий список с дополнительными опциями. Выберите пункт "Открыть и восстановить". Этот встроенный инструмент попытается проанализировать поврежденную структуру и исправить логические ошибки в заголовках файла, игнорируя незначительные несоответствия формата.

☑️ Чек-лист действий при ошибке открытия

Выполнено: 0 / 5

Существует еще один метод, связанный с перетаскиванием. Откройте пустой лист Excel, затем перетащите иконку проблемного файла прямо на рабочую область программы. Иногда этот обходной путь позволяет миновать стандартные проверки безопасности, которые срабатывают при прямом запуске через проводник. Если и этот способ не помог, возможно, повреждения коснулись критических секторов данных.

⚠️ Внимание: При использовании функции восстановления программа может удалить часть данных, которые сочтет поврежденными. Всегда сохраняйте восстановленную версию под новым именем, чтобы не перезаписать оригинал.

Смена расширения и конвертация форматов

Часто проблема решается простой, но эффективной манипуляцией с расширением файла. Если у вас есть файл с расширением .xls, который не открывается, попробуйте переименовать его, сменив расширение на .xlsx, или наоборот. Windows спросит подтверждение на изменение расширения — соглашайтесь. Это действие заставляет систему заново проанализировать заголовок файла.

Однако простое переименование работает не всегда, особенно если внутренняя структура действительно отличается. В таких случаях помогает использование онлайн-конвертеров или сторонних программ-вьюверов. Загрузите файл в Google Таблицы или LibreOffice Calc. Эти программы часто менее требовательны к строгому соответствию стандартов и могут открыть файл, который отверг Excel.

После успешного открытия в альтернативной программе необходимо выполнить экспорт. Выберите Файл → Скачать как → Microsoft Excel (.xlsx). При этом создается новый файл с чистой и корректной структурой, полностью соответствующей современным стандартам офисных форматов.

Для продвинутых пользователей существует метод открытия через текстовый редактор. Если файл имеет формат .csv или .txt, но почему-то помечен как бинарный, его можно открыть в Блокноте. Убедившись, что внутри виден читаемый текст с разделителями (запятыми или табуляцией), сохраните файл с явным указанием кодировки UTF-8 и правильным расширением.

Почему расширение .xlsb иногда решает проблему?

Формат .xlsb является бинарным и часто используется для очень больших таблиц. Он менее подвержен ошибкам целостности XML-структуры, характерным для .xlsx, поэтому конвертация в этот формат может "залечить" логические разрывы в файле.

Настройка центра управления безопасностью Excel

Если вы работаете с файлами из доверенного источника, но блокировка продолжается, возможно, настройки безопасности в Excel слишком строги. Перейдите в Файл → Параметры → Центр управления безопасностью и нажмите кнопку "Параметры центра управления безопасностью". Здесь находится ключевой раздел для управления блокировками.

В открывшемся окне выберите вкладку "Параметры блокировки файлов". Здесь представлен список старых форматов и типов файлов, которые могут быть заблокированы. Убедитесь, что галочки "Открывать" и "Сохранять" для нужных вам типов файлов активны. Снятие ограничений позволяет программе игнорировать предупреждения о несоответствии версий.

Также стоит проверить раздел "Надежные расположения". Добавив папку, в которой хранятся ваши рабочие файлы, в список надежных, вы автоматически снимаете с них большинство проверок безопасности. Для этого перейдите в соответствующий подраздел и нажмите "Добавить новое расположение", указав путь к директории на диске.

| Параметр настройки | Расположение в меню | Рекомендуемое значение | Влияние на безопасность |

| :--- | :--- | :--- |--- |

| Защищенный просмотр | Центр управления безопасностью | Включено для файлов из интернета | Высокое (базовая защита) |

| Блокировка старых форматов | Параметры блокировки файлов | Снято для доверенных источников | Среднее (риск макросов) |

| Надежные расположения | Центр управления безопасностью | Добавлены рабочие папки | Низкое (для локальных файлов) |

| Макросы | Параметры макросов | Отключать с уведомлением | Высокое (защита от вирусов) |

Будьте осторожны при глобальном отключении проверок. Параметры безопасности созданы не просто так, и их ослабление повышает уязвимость системы перед макровирусами, которые часто распространяются именно через таблицы.

Восстановление поврежденных данных

Когда стандартные методы не помогают, и файл продолжает выдавать ошибку о недопустимом формате, возможно, повреждение носит серьезный характер. В этом случае стоит попробовать открыть файл в Excel в безопасном режиме. Для этого зажмите клавишу Ctrl при запуске программы и подтвердите вход в безопасный режим. Затем попробуйте открыть файл через меню "Открыть".

Если и это не помогло, можно воспользоваться сторонними утилитами для восстановления, такими как Recovery Toolbox for Excel или аналогами. Эти программы умеют читать сырые данные файла, игнорируя заголовки и структуру, и вытаскивать оттуда ячейки с информацией. Результат обычно сохраняется в новый, чистый файл.

В крайнем случае, если файл критически важен, а автоматические средства бессильны, можно попробовать открыть его как архив. Формат .xlsx технически является ZIP-архивом. Попробуйте переименовать расширение файла на .zip и открыть его архиватором. Если внутри вы видите папки xl, _rels, значит, структура цела, и файл можно попытаться распаковать и собрать заново, заменив поврежденные XML-части.

⚠️ Внимание: Манипуляции с переименованием в ZIP-архив и редактирование XML-файлов внутри требуют высокой квалификации. Неосторожное изменение структуры может сделать восстановление невозможным.

Часто задаваемые вопросы (FAQ)

Почему файл открывается на одном компьютере, но не открывается на другом?

Это может быть связано с разными версиями Microsoft Excel, установленными на компьютерах. Старая версия может не поддерживать новые функции или форматы, созданные в новой версии. Также могут отличаться настройки Центра управления безопасностью или отсутствовать необходимые кодеки и обновления системы.

Может ли антивирус блокировать открытие файла с ошибкой формата?

Да, современные антивирусы часто интегрируются с офисными пакетами. Если антивиус подозревает, что несоответствие формата является признаком вредоносного кода (например, скрипт внутри картинки), он может блокировать открытие файла до завершения проверки или полностью запрещать доступ.

Как предотвратить появление этой ошибки в будущем при сохранении?

Всегда используйте стандартную процедуру Файл → Сохранить как и выбирайте актуальные форматы (.xlsx). Избегайте ручного переименования расширений в проводнике. Регулярно обновляйте офисный пакет, чтобы обеспечивать совместимость со новыми стандартами.

Что делать, если файл имеет расширение .xlsm и не открывается?

Расширение .xlsm означает, что файл содержит макросы. Проверьте настройки макросов в Центре управления безопасностью. Возможно, исполнение макросов отключено, или файл заблокирован, так как происходит из непроверенного источника. Попробуйте включить содержимое через желтую полосу предупреждения.